How Sleeping on Your Left Side Impacts Health

Sleeping on your left side offers several surprising health benefits, influencing digestion, circulation, and even sleep quality. One of the most recognized advantages is its effect on acid reflux. When you lie on your left side, the stomach rests below the esophagus, reducing the chance of stomach acid flowing upward and causing heartburn.

For people with gastroesophageal reflux disease (GERD), this small change can bring major relief and help ensure a more restful night’s sleep.
